About Pro-Serv Food Equipment Pro-Serv is a rapidly growing commercial kitchen equipment service company serving North and South Carolina. We specialize in commercial HVAC, refrigeration, and cooking equipment. Were not your average service company we hold our team to the highest standards in quality, customer service, and performance.

Key Responsibilities

Lead and execute installations of HVAC, refrigeration, and kitchen equipment (grills, fryers, ovens, walk-ins, etc.)

Oversee helper/install crew and ensure installs are done to code and Pro-Serv standards

Read and interpret installation manuals, blueprints, and spec sheets

Communicate with customers, subcontractors, and internal teams throughout the install process

Ensure safety, cleanliness, and proper documentation on every job

Troubleshoot system issues during and after install as needed

Deliver a professional and high-quality experience to every customer

Requirements

5+ years of install experience in HVAC, refrigeration, or commercial kitchen equipment

Universal EPA Certification (required)

Valid drivers license with clean driving record

Ability to lead a job site and direct helpers or subcontractors

Strong mechanical and electrical troubleshooting skills

Professional appearance and communication

Must be able to lift 75+ lbs, climb ladders, and work in varying conditions

Ability to travel for installs when needed
